Transaction ea323055224b03e1aa3080f3056f73164d30f0ee6191e128fc483a8163773c2c
1 Input
1 Output
-
ea323055224b03e1aa3080f3056f73164d30f0ee6191e128fc483a8163773c2c:0
- value
- 562116
- script pubkey
- OP_0 OP_PUSHBYTES_20 58b8b69987ca4a66f027ef82fd8193240948a2fd
- address
- bc1qtzutdxv8ef9xdup8a7p0mqvnysy53ghadx9j3v